Stage 4 Al Henakiyah → Al Ula
As hard as the first few days may have been, this will be no time to falter. The marathon stage is going to be a hell of a ride.
ℹ️ Route info ℹ️
Entrants should be wary of the volcanic terrain. The technical tracks leading to Al Ula will plunge the field into the splendid canyons for which the region is famous. The finish line will be set up inside the dedicated bivouac, which is off limits to service vehicles.
Liaison
173 km
Special Stage
415 km
Motorbike riders will be given just an hour and a half to work on their mounts. As for the cars, there will no restrictions on mutual aid.
📝 Mixed Fortunes for Marathon Stage 📝
ALULA – Vaidotas Žala finished fourth in the first part of the Dakar Rally’s marathon stage on Wednesday. The Lithuanian truck driver and his crew encountered problems with their Iveco after a flat tire but managed to minimize the damage. Anja van Loon and her brothers Ben and Jan van de Laar secured an impressive seventh place. Aleš Loprais had an unfortunate day, finishing ninth.
The 588-kilometer stage from Al Henakiyah to Alula proved challenging for the Dakar participants. Much of the 415-kilometer special stage traversed volcanic terrain with sharp rocks and boulders. Many drivers experienced punctures, including Žala.
Best performance
Anja van Loon of the Fried van de Laar Racing Team de Rooy FPT had her best performance yet in the first day of the marathon stage, finishing seventh. However, Loprais wasn’t as fortunate.
The second part of the marathon stage takes place Thursday, covering 492 kilometers from Alula to Hail, including a 428-kilometer special stage.
Issues
“It was an extremely difficult day”, said the Skuba Team de Rooy FPT driver at the Alula bivouac, where teams couldn’t fall back on their support crews.
“We had a flat tire. Afterward, we experienced some issues that prevented us from maintaining full speed. We hope to reach the marathon stage finish line tomorrow.”
Žala took responsibility for the puncture and its effects. “I believe it’s my fault. We were pushing hard when we had this major impact. Now, the truck’s steering is compromised. I think we’ll make it through. We need to inspect the vehicle now, but we can’t perform any substantial repairs here without our mechanics.”
Bad luck
The Instatrade Team de Rooy FPT driver suffered three punctures.
He found himself in the dust of competitors who had passed him and his crew. This cost significant time, resulting in a ninth-place finish.
